In 2023, Brooksville, FL had a population of 9.24k people with a median age of 52.4 and a median household income of $47,796. Between 2022 and 2023 the population of Brooksville, FL grew from 8,981 to 9,235, a 2.83% increase and its median household income grew from $42,047 to $47,796, a 13.7% increase.
The 5 largest ethnic groups in Brooksville, FL are White (Non-Hispanic) (64.4%), Black or African American (Non-Hispanic) (13.3%), Two+ (Hispanic) (8.46%), White (Hispanic) (5.97%), and Other (Hispanic) (3.52%).
None of the households in Brooksville, FL reported speaking a non-English language at home as their primary shared language. This does not consider the potential multi-lingual nature of households, but only the primary self-reported language spoken by all members of the household.
97.6% of the residents in Brooksville, FL are U.S. citizens.
In 2023, the median property value in Brooksville, FL was $112,400, and the homeownership rate was 62.2%.
Most people in Brooksville, FL drove alone to work, and the average commute time was 30.5 minutes. The average car ownership in Brooksville, FL was 2 cars per household.
